Description | Sommerville: Carnelian. A Bacchanalian, pouring out a vase of wine on an animal's head. Intaglios and Their Imprints, Case AAA. Vermeule: Carnelian. Intaglio. (Unmounted) A young satyr seated to right, on a rock, thyrsus in his left hand, his right held out over the head of a goat. He appears to hold a small cup in this hand. Graeco-Roman, in rather good style. |
